LGBTQ MEMBERS FINDING COMMUNITY THROUGH INCLUSIVE FAITH COMMUNITIES

2 min read Queer

LGBTQ stands for Lesbian, Gay, Bisexual, Transgender, Queer or Questioning. These terms refer to people who identify themselves as part of these groups. Inclusive faith communities are religious organizations that accept and welcome everyone regardless of their sexual orientation, gender identity, or expression. This includes members who identify as LGBTQ, those who may not identify themselves but have same-sex attractions or relationships, and anyone else who does not fit into traditional gender roles or identities.

Participation in inclusive faith communities can impact ethical reasoning and spiritual development for LGBTQ individuals in several ways. One way is through increased exposure to diverse perspectives and ideas about faith and religion. When members of an inclusive community share their experiences and beliefs openly, it helps create an environment where everyone feels safe and accepted. This can lead to more open communication, greater understanding, and deeper exploration of faith-based concepts such as love, justice, compassion, and forgiveness.

Participating in an inclusive community provides opportunities for members to develop new relationships and build support networks within the group. Through social interactions with other LGBTQ individuals, they learn how others approach life, handle challenges, and navigate difficult situations. They also gain a sense of belonging and community, which helps them feel more connected to God and their fellow believers.

Participation in an inclusive community encourages members to question their own values and beliefs, and consider how they apply to their lives. By engaging in discussions about faith and spirituality, they are able to challenge assumptions and stereotypes, broaden their worldview, and explore new perspectives on morality and ethics. This can result in personal growth and transformation, leading to a stronger connection to both God and the larger community.

Involvement in inclusive faith communities can be beneficial for LGBTQ individuals by providing them with a safe space to express themselves, connect with others who share similar identities, and grow spiritually through conversations and activities centered around faith and religion.

Not all communities offer equal levels of support or acceptance, so it is important for members to carefully choose the right fit for them based on their needs and preferences.
